Overview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g Tablet
Cholestaguard 10mg/10mg tablets effectively manage elevated cholesterol. This dual-action formulation lowers LDL ("bad") cholesterol and triglyceride levels. Cholestaguard can be administered with or without food, consistently at prescribed intervals for optimal results. Maintain a regular daily schedule to improve adherence. Treatment length and dosage vary based on individual needs. Complete the full course, even if symptoms improve. Lifestyle modifications, such as regular physical activity, smoking cessation, and a balanced, low-fat diet, enhance its effectiveness. Common, generally mild side effects include nausea, abdominal discomfort, constipation, and myalgia. Report persistent or bothersome side effects. Immediately report jaundice, dark urine, or dark stools, as these may indicate liver complications. Regular blood sugar and liver function tests may be necessary. Inform your physician of any pre-existing kidney or liver conditions, hypertension, or pregnancy/breastfeeding status before commencing treatment. Always disclose all medications to your healthcare provider due to potential interactions.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Consuming alcohol while taking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ets is inadvisable.
PregnancyUNSAFE
The use of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ets is strongly contraindicated during pregnancy. Pregnant women should consult their physician, as research in both animal models and pregnant humans has revealed substantial adverse effects on fetal development.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, and cause drowsiness or dizziness. Refrain from driving if these effects are experienced.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ets are considered safe for use in individuals with kidney impairment. No alteration of the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ablet dosage is necessary.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Medical advice is necessary.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g tablets are contraindicated for individuals with moderate to severe hepatic dysfunction.
What if you forget to take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g Tablet :
Should you forget a Cardiozen EZ 10mg/10mg Tablet dose, take it promptly. Nevertheless, if your next d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
